daddy/Makefile
William Petit 1120474ad9 Utilisation d'un serveur Go custom pour le backend au lieu de
super-graph

Malheureusement, super-graph n'a pas tenu les promesses qu'il semblait
annoncer.

Je propose donc de basculer sur un serveur Go classique (via goweb).
L'authentification OpenID Connect étant gérée côté backend et non plus
côté frontend.
2020-07-12 19:14:46 +02:00

29 lines
487 B
Makefile

build: build-docker build-server
build-docker:
docker-compose build
build-server:
CGO_ENABLED=0 go build -mod=vendor -v -o ./bin/server ./cmd/server
deps:
cd client && npm install
env GO111MODULE=off go get github.com/cortesi/modd/cmd/modd
up: build-docker
docker-compose up
watch:
$(GOPATH)/bin/modd
down:
docker-compose down -v --remove-orphans
db-shell:
docker-compose exec postgres psql -Udaddy
test:
go test -v ./...
hydra-shell:
docker-compose exec hydra /bin/sh